Breakthroughs in Quantum Technology

Recent advancements have seen quantum computers achieve ‘quantum supremacy’, where these machines can perform calculations that are practically impossible for classical computers. This milestone opens new avenues for complex problem-solving and optimization tasks across different sectors.

Quantum Security in a Digital World

With cyber threats growing more sophisticated, quantum computing offers a promising solution in the form of quantum cryptography. This method uses the principles of quantum mechanics to secure data in a way that is virtually unbreakable by conventional methods.
